Output 74b124a752dd082d7240c17b48fa1fc4470a21c2a1c6ebbb067b8d1fda3c76f8:0

value
65395700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4abeb81a0ffc812717719436dc4fb46ce3eb2c OP_EQUAL
address
MCDDXpVVmT9P24dFp4kf7iHNumtKViBRpG
transaction
74b124a752dd082d7240c17b48fa1fc4470a21c2a1c6ebbb067b8d1fda3c76f8
spent
true